CR: Police Nab Suspects Who Kidnapped Medical Doctor in Bakassi

The Police in Cross River State have arrested three suspects, Samuel Ime Thompson, 25, Kingsley Mbetobong, 23 and Asuquo Ekpo Etim, 26, in connection with the kidnap of one Edmund Akpaikpe, a medical doctor with Irua Specialist Hospital, Edo state, around Esigi village in Bakassi Local Government Area of the state.

Akpaikpe was kidnapped this past Sunday in Bakassi where he had gone to drop off his maid at Esigi village. He regained his freedom on Tuesday after the Anti Kidnapping & Cultism Squad, AKCS, after a frantic search and rescue operation, closed in on the suspects at a location in the forest where the victim was taken to. Chased and hemmed in by the police, the suspects abandoned the victim’s vehicle, a black Toyota Camry with registration number, AAA 564 BZ which was also recoverd by the police.

Irene Ugbo, a Deputy Superintendent of Police, DSP and Police Public Relations Officer, PPRO, CRS Police Command, who confirmed the arrest of the suspects, told journalists that the spate of kidnapping in the country was saddening and alarming, “especially now that we are coming to the end of the year.” She added that a lot of criminally minded individuals now use the excuse of trying to meet up to get into various crimes including kidnapping and assured that the police will leave no stone unturned in arresting and prosecuting individuals or groups who take to crime.
